As part of the PERM Labor Certification (PERM) process, an employer must obtain a Prevailing Wage Determination (PWD) from the Department of Labors (DOL) National Prevailing Wage Center (NPWC). The employer is required to pay the fees associated with the PERM process, not the employee. The Prevailing Wage Determination (PWD) and testing the recruitment process are the two main steps involved in the PERM process. DOL determines the prevailing wages for the proffered position based on minimum requirements such as education, experience, and work location. Before a U.S. employer can petition to sponsor an immigrant workerin certain categories of employment, it mustobtainan approved PERM Labor Certification from the DOLby demonstrating thatamong otherconditionsthere are not sufficient U.S. workers to fill the position. The process also includesobtaining a Prevailing Wage Determination (PWD)from DOLthat sets the required minimum wage for theoccupation and geographic areaof intended employment.
